Cole’s agent hails switch to Blues as Arsenal struggle

Former England international Ashley Cole’s agent Jonathan Barnett believes his switch from Arsenal to Chelsea was a fantastic move.

The 34-year-old left Arsenal for Stamford Bridge in 2006 for ÂŁ5 million, seeing William Gallas go the other way. But his agent admits that move would never have happened, had Arsenal stuck to their word.

“If Arsenal hadn’t gone back on their word, Ashley would have stayed 100% and that would never have happened.” Barnett told The Guardian, when speaking of the Gunners’ ÂŁ55,000-a-week contract offer to Cole.

It was understood the deal was meant to be around ÂŁ60,000-a-week, which left the England left-back angered and subsequently moving across London to Chelsea.

Financial rewards for Cole

Barnett believes Cole has benefitted from the issues at Arsenal, by enjoying a more financially rewarding and successful career in west London.

“But it was probably the best thing that ever happened to Ashley Cole.” Barnett added.

“Arsenal won nothing, he won everything and financially he was much better off.

“My job as an agent was done.”

Cole went on to win the league, four FA Cups, one League Cup, a Community Shield, the Champions League and Europa League with Chelsea. While Arsenal have not won the title since 2004, when Cole was still with the club.

The former England left-back made a total of 229 league appearances for the Blues, scoring seven times, and has made 16 appearances for current club AS Roma in Serie A this season.
